Output 1ab30d40faae2d34b1908d4af1a6419bc898a3c9a92acfd7135ff405cea8aab7:3

value
42389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5270290ae47cc3211c98d1e21d613c7e8c438f OP_EQUAL
address
3QbtHbSYs7Fbk1ZkFhc2ZpvfGdJMSKUYsq
transaction
1ab30d40faae2d34b1908d4af1a6419bc898a3c9a92acfd7135ff405cea8aab7
spent
true